Как использовать transcrypt в Python - PullRequest
0 голосов
/ 21 февраля 2020

Я пытаюсь привести несколько простых примеров, таких как пример дерева черепах (https://github.com/bunkahle/Transcrypt-Examples/tree/master/turtle), используя Pyhton 3.7.6 и transcrypt 3.7.16.

По сути, я просто помещаю .py в папку и выполняю расшифровку из cmd, выполняя:

"python -m transcrypt -n turtle_tree.py";

Кажется, все в порядке, ошибки не отображаются. После этого я изменил строку 20 файла html с записью "_ _ target_ _/turtle_tree.js", поскольку выходные данные не находятся в папке _ _ javascript_ _.

Когда я открываю html, он открывается пустым.

Кто-нибудь может понять, что я делаю не так? И если кто-то может предоставить мне некоторую документацию об этой библиотеке, я был бы признателен.

1 Ответ

0 голосов
/ 24 февраля 2020

Строка 20 должна быть заменена, очевидно, в тегах скрипта, на:

 type="module"> import * as turtle_tree from './__target__/turtle_tree.js'; window.turtle_tree = turtle_tree;

Затем из cmd внутри вашей папки вы должны открыть http-сервер:

python -m http.server

Наконец, из вашего браузера вы должны набрать:

http://localhost:8000/turtle_tree.html

Это было так же просто, как следовать документам Transcrypt v.v '

2.2. Ваша первая программа Transcrypt: https://www.transcrypt.org/docs/html/installation_use.html#your -первая-программа транскрипции

...